What is the primary function of the mechanical digestion process in the mouth?
Cutting, tearing, and grinding of food
What is the result of chemical digestion of proteins in the digestive system?
Peptides and amino acids
What type of epithelial tissue lines the oesophagus?
Stratified squamous epithelial tissue
What is the primary function of the stomach in the digestive system?
Churning of food to mix with digestive enzymes
What is the role of bile in the digestive system?
Emulsification of fats into droplets
What is the function of the pancreas in the digestive system?
Production of digestive enzymes to break down nutrients
What is the main function of the salivary amylase in the saliva?
Breaks down starch into disaccharides
Which type of muscle is responsible for the movement of food through the oesophagus?
Smooth muscle
What is the primary function of the liver in the excretory system?
To prepare materials for excretion
What is the main role of the rugae in the stomach?
Folding of the stomach wall to increase surface area
What is the process of removing nitrogen from amino acids and nitrogen bases called?
Deamination
What is the name of the enzyme that breaks down proteins into peptides in the stomach?
Pepsin
What is the role of the skin in the excretory system?
To secrete oil and water, and excrete some drugs and waste
What is the purpose of the pyloric sphincter in the stomach?
To regulate the transfer of chyme into the duodenum
What is the functional unit of the kidneys?
Nephron
Which of the following is NOT a function of the oesophagus?
Absorption of nutrients into the bloodstream
What is the process of removing waste substances from the blood in the kidneys?
Filtration
What is the primary function of the stomach in the digestive process?
Storage and breakdown of food through mechanical and chemical digestion
What is the role of podocytes in the glomerular capsule?
To wrap around capillaries of the glomerulus
What is the term for the fluid that is formed during filtration in the kidneys?
Filtrate
What is the role of bile in the digestive process?
Physically breaks down fats into smaller units
What is the primary function of the mucosa in the stomach?
Protection of the stomach from acidic chyme and bacteria
What is the process of returning useful substances to the blood from the filtrate?
Reabsorption
Which of the following types of teeth is responsible for tearing food?
Canines
What is the hormone that regulates the permeability of the collecting duct?
ADH
What is the term for the movement of substances from the blood into the filtrate?
Secretion
